Lakshminath Bezbaruah Commemorative Stamp
2022-06-30 Thu
Lakshminath Bezbaruah was an Assamese poet, novelist, and playwright of modern Assamese literature. Lakshminath Bezbaruah was an honest writer of Assamese Literature and a powerful voice for the creative and intellectual resurgence of modern India. He responded to the prevailing social environment through his satirical works to bring and sustain positive changes to the former.During this time, the famous Assamese Journal 'Jonaki' was launched under the leadership of Chandra Kumar Agarwala. Lakshminath Bezbaruah's works represented the contemporary modern Assamese mind through which streamed forth a reawakening of the language, literature, culture, and society of Assam.
The Government of India issued this commemorative stamp on LakshminathBezbaruah in 1968 to commemorate him and his work.
